New description: [New technical field] [0001] This creation relates to a lamp socket structure, especially a top-supported lamp socket structure. [Previous Art] [0002] As shown in FIG. 9, a conventional lamp socket structure includes a body 90, a rotating member 9 1 and a metal clip 915. The body 90 is internally disposed. The metal piece 9 5 and the body 90 extends at the center with a support column 92. The support column 92 is composed of two opposite side wings 902, and each of the side wings 9 2 0 is outwardly facing outward. The protruding member 9 1 is pivoted to the body 90, and the rotating member 9 1 has a longitudinal insertion hole 9 1 〇, and the insertion hole 9 1 0 Each of the two sides of the inner side is provided with a positioning portion 9 1 1 , and each of the positioning portions 9 1 1 can be blocked and positioned by the blocking portion 9 21 of each of the side wings 9 2 0 . [0003] Referring again to FIG. 10, each of the bodies 90 is disposed at each end of a socket 9 3, and a lamp tube 4 is configured to be set. When the lamp tube 94 is installed between the lamp sockets, as shown in the first drawing, the two terminals 940 provided at both ends of the lamp tube 94 are vertically placed in the respective positions. The rotating member 9 1 is inserted into the hole 9 1 , and the lamp 9 4 is rotated to drive the two terminals 94 to rotate the rotating member 9 1 by ninety degrees. At this time, the two terminals 9 4 0 can be The body 90 is clamped and electrically connected by the metal clips 95, and is electrically connected to the power source and positioned to the lamp tube 94. [〇〇〇4] If an earthquake occurs, since the lamp 9 4 is only laterally clamped by the metal clip 9 5 at the two terminals 9 4 0, when the lamp form number A0101 3 pages/total 22 pages M421445 [0005] [0007] [0008] [0009] Form number A0101 4 suffers from lateral sway, which causes the lamp 9 4 to laterally slip and will cause the lamp to be caused The terminal of the 9 4 bis 9 4 0 is separated from the clamping of the metal clip 9 5; as shown in FIG. 1 , if the ceiling or the wooden board is deformed by a strong earthquake, the terminals 9 4 of the tube 9 4 at this time. The case of 0 detachment from the metal clip 9 5 will be more pronounced, and the lamp tube 94 will be more likely to fall and pose a danger. Therefore, how to solve the problem of the above lamp socket structure is the focus of this creation. [New content] The main purpose of the present invention is to solve the above problems and provide a top-supporting lamp socket structure, wherein the lamp holder has a top support member pushed by an elastic member, and a rotating member can be used When the top support is pushed up by the elastic member and is actuated at the same time, when a light tube is installed in the socket of the lamp, the rotating member will be pushed toward the side of the tube, so that the tube can be surely positioned at ordinary times. In the lamp socket, if an earthquake occurs, the side of the lamp can be buffered by the actuating stroke of the top member to prevent the lamp from slipping out of the lamp socket. , to prevent the lamp from falling and causing personal injury. The embodiment provides a top-supporting lamp socket structure, as shown in FIG. 1 to FIG. 3, comprising a base 1, an elastic member 2, a top support member 3, an upper cover 4, and a receiving portion 5. A metal clip 6 and a rotary member form No. A0101 Page 5 of 22 M421445 7, wherein: [0017] The base 1 has a first plug portion 1 两侧 on both sides of the bottom, and the upward extension member There is an actuating portion 1 1 and a further first plug portion 10 at the top end of the actuating portion 1 1 . The actuating portion 1 1 extends laterally with a hollow supporting column 12 2 . The two side flaps 1 2 0 are formed and the two side flaps 120 are oppositely disposed, and each of the side flaps 1 2 0 protrudes outwardly from the top end with a blocking portion 1 2 1 , and the elastic member 2 is received on the supporting column In the case of 1 2, it means that the elastic member 2 is accommodated between the two side flaps 120. [(8)18] The top support member 3 is in the form of a disk in the embodiment, and the top support member 3 has two perforations 3 1 corresponding to each of the side wings 1 2 0 for each of the side wings 1 20 to penetrate, and the The elastic member 2 has an end against the bottom of the support column 12, and the other end abuts against the bottom of the top support 3. [0019] In addition, the upper cover 4 has a second insertion portion 40 on both sides of the bottom portion, and the upper cover 4 has a cover portion 4 1 extending upwardly and another portion at the top end of the cover portion 41. The second cover portion 4 〇 has a through hole 4 1 〇, and the upper cover 4 is respectively joined to the base by the two sides of the bottom portion and the second insertion portion 4 顶端 at the top end of the cover portion 4 Each of the first plug portions 10 is coupled to the base 1 such that the cover portion 41 is in contact with the actuating portion 11 to form the receiving portion 5, and the receiving portion 5 is a chamber. A metal clip 6 is disposed in the accommodating portion 5. [0020] Further, the rotating member 7 is disposed on the cover portion 4 1 of the upper cover 4 and passes through the through hole 410 and is supported by the top support member. 3 The top of the top is pushed outwardly, and the form has a plug hole 7 〇, and a positioning portion 7 1 is disposed on each side of the insertion hole 7 分别, and the two positioning portions 7 1 can be respectively The flank of the flank 1 2 0 blocks the positioning, and has a guiding section 7 2 on each side of each positioning portion 7 1 , and each guiding section 7 2 is provided for the rotating component 7 When rotating, the flaps 1 2 1 of the side flaps 1 2 1 Potential retracted. Since the rotating member 7 is pushed outward by the supporting member 3, when the rotating member 7 is pressed, it is retracted toward the covering portion 41 of the upper cover 4, and when the rotating member is rotated When the piece 7 is released from pressing, it will be pushed outward by the top support 3 to eject and reset. [0021] Referring to FIG. 4, when a lamp tube 8 is mounted to the socket structure of the embodiment, the two terminals 80 of the two ends are longitudinally slid into the insertion hole 70. At this time, as shown in FIG. 5, the two end faces of the lamp tube 8 are respectively supported toward the corresponding rotating members 7, so that the two rotating members 7 are retracted toward the cover portion 41 of the upper cover 4, and As shown in FIG. 6, the two terminals 80 drive the two rotating members 8 to rotate the rotating member 7 by ninety degrees. At this time, the two terminals 80 can be clipped to the metal in the receiving portion 5. 6 is electrically connected, and the two terminals 80 are sandwiched by the metal clips 6. [0022] As shown in FIG. 7 , since the sides of the lamp tube 8 are respectively pushed by the force of the two rotating members 7 to be ejected outward, thereby forming a clamping effect on the tube 8 , When an earthquake occurs, the two sides of the lamp tube 8 can still be positioned between the two sockets by the pushing of the rotating member 7; and as shown in Fig. 8, if the lamp holder is deformed and bent, each of the lamps When the distance between the sockets is increased, the two terminals 80 at both ends of the lamp tube 8 can be prevented from being clamped and electrically connected by the metal elastic piece 6 during the ejecting process. The lamp 8 is detached from between the two socket structures to prevent the person from being injured by the lamp 8.
